"Snow, snow, snow. Too much snow!" read a social media post today from Weyburn's Mayor Marcel Roy.

"If you don’t have to drive please avoid travel as it will take time to clear passageways. We will once again dig our way out of winter and hopefully find spring soon!"

This is the sentiment across social media from locals today, with more than 40 cm of snow measured downtown having fallen since yesterday morning.

The City of Weyburn's leisure facilities are closed this morning, and reopening will be looked at later today, and updates will be provided this afternoon.

Snow removal focus for April 20 remains on priority routes, secondary will begin once Public Works determines priority routes are fully complete. Downtown removal is anticipated for tomorrow as the snow is too damp for snow blowers (the equipment needed to clear downtown streets).

Recycling collection in Area 2 has been postponed April 20, Area 2 and 3 will be collected Friday. Garbage collection for Areas 1 and 2 will also happen on Friday.

The landfill remains closed today.

City Hall is open today, but a number of Weyburn organizations and businesses have closed their doors and are calling it a snow day.

The Prairie Sky Coop Food Store is currently open, but the parking lot is still being cleared and there will be no deliveries available today. The Coop Home Centre is closed today.
